Google Cloud is seeking a Software Engineer III to join their Infrastructure team focusing on Cloud Compute Infrastructure. This role is critical in developing and maintaining the architecture that powers Google's vast product portfolio. The position requires expertise in C++ programming and experience with large-scale infrastructure or distributed systems.
As a Software Engineer III, you'll be working on Google Cloud's infrastructure, which accelerates organizations' digital transformation capabilities. You'll be part of the Technical Infrastructure team that builds and maintains Google's data centers and platforms, ensuring optimal performance and reliability of Google's services used by billions of users worldwide.
The role offers an excellent compensation package ranging from $141,000 to $202,000 base salary, plus bonus, equity, and comprehensive benefits. You'll be based in Kirkland, WA, working with cutting-edge technology and contributing to systems that operate at massive scale.
Key responsibilities include writing system development code, participating in design reviews, reviewing other developers' code, contributing to documentation, and troubleshooting complex system issues. You'll work with distributed systems, compute technologies, and storage architecture, requiring both technical expertise and problem-solving skills.
The ideal candidate should have at least 2 years of experience with C++ development and large-scale infrastructure, though candidates with advanced degrees may qualify with 1 year of experience. You'll be joining a team that takes pride in being "engineers' engineers" and focuses on building and maintaining the next generation of Google platforms.
This role offers significant growth opportunities as Google Cloud continues to expand its enterprise-grade solutions and tools for developers. You'll be working with customers across 200+ countries, helping solve critical business problems through innovative technology solutions.
The position requires strong collaboration skills as you'll work with peers and stakeholders to make technical decisions and ensure best practices in code development. You'll also contribute to Google's culture of accessibility and inclusive technology development.
If you're passionate about large-scale systems, distributed computing, and want to work on technology that impacts billions of users, this role offers an excellent opportunity to grow your career at one of the world's leading technology companies.